Ancient history as seen through the eyes of children. All of the stories in this book are set in the Sicilian city of Syracuse, ranging from the era of Greek influence to the rise of the Rome and the coming of Christianity, from c. 500 BC to 330 AD. In the six stories, fictional boys and girls meet and mingle with historical figures such as the great inventor Archimedes. This is the first of three books designed to introduce the sweep of European history and the rise and fall of civilizations through the eyes of children in Syracuse.
